Transaction 7adca84f491b1835d991032951df7313bf4655aebc3f637e51d005a8d027c953

5 Input
2 Outputs
  • 7adca84f491b1835d991032951df7313bf4655aebc3f637e51d005a8d027c953:0
  • value  50000000
    address  16hV7gHufrvDLTipT9Ahecf8K11BazLxZ4
  • 7adca84f491b1835d991032951df7313bf4655aebc3f637e51d005a8d027c953:1
  • value  4593444
    address  19QyQSRJBRAckZUhM4jrmcardqQpeM82Jc